diff options
-rwxr-xr-x | src/com/android/camera/PhotoModule.java | 27 | ||||
-rw-r--r-- | src/com/android/camera/VideoModule.java | 27 |
2 files changed, 9 insertions, 45 deletions
diff --git a/src/com/android/camera/PhotoModule.java b/src/com/android/camera/PhotoModule.java index eb8a2f5e5..57ae68fe4 100755 --- a/src/com/android/camera/PhotoModule.java +++ b/src/com/android/camera/PhotoModule.java @@ -757,15 +757,6 @@ public class PhotoModule openCameraCommon(); resizeForPreviewAspectRatio(); updateFocusManager(mUI); - mActivity.runOnUiThread(new Runnable() { - public void run() { - Size size = mParameters.getPreviewSize(); - SurfaceHolder sh = mUI.getSurfaceHolder(); - if ( sh != null ){ - sh.setFixedSize(size.width-2, size.height-2); - } - } - }); } private void switchCamera() { @@ -821,15 +812,15 @@ public class PhotoModule // Start switch camera animation. Post a message because // onFrameAvailable from the old camera may already exist. mHandler.sendEmptyMessage(SWITCH_CAMERA_START_ANIMATION); - mActivity.runOnUiThread(new Runnable() { - public void run() { - Size size = mParameters.getPreviewSize(); - SurfaceHolder sh = mUI.getSurfaceHolder(); - if ( sh != null ){ - sh.setFixedSize(size.width-2, size.height-2); - } - } - }); + mActivity.runOnUiThread(new Runnable() { + public void run() { + Size size = mParameters.getPreviewSize(); + SurfaceHolder sh = mUI.getSurfaceHolder(); + if ( sh != null ){ + sh.setFixedSize(size.width-2, size.height-2); + } + } + }); } diff --git a/src/com/android/camera/VideoModule.java b/src/com/android/camera/VideoModule.java index f0e7e1c25..c961bb24d 100644 --- a/src/com/android/camera/VideoModule.java +++ b/src/com/android/camera/VideoModule.java @@ -285,15 +285,6 @@ public class VideoModule implements CameraModule, } mParameters = mCameraDevice.getParameters(); mPreviewFocused = arePreviewControlsVisible(); - mActivity.runOnUiThread(new Runnable() { - public void run() { - Size size = mParameters.getPreviewSize(); - SurfaceHolder sh = mUI.getSurfaceHolder(); - if ( sh != null ){ - sh.setFixedSize(size.width-2, size.height-2); - } - } - }); } //QCOM data Members Starts here @@ -1258,15 +1249,6 @@ public class VideoModule implements CameraModule, @Override public void onPreviewFrame(byte[] data, CameraProxy camera) { mUI.hidePreviewCover(); - mActivity.runOnUiThread(new Runnable() { - public void run() { - Size size = mParameters.getPreviewSize(); - SurfaceHolder sh = mUI.getSurfaceHolder(); - if ( sh != null ){ - sh.setFixedSize(size.width+2, size.height+2); - } - } - }); } }); mCameraDevice.startPreview(); @@ -2960,15 +2942,6 @@ public class VideoModule implements CameraModule, //Display timelapse msg depending upon selection in front/back camera. mUI.showTimeLapseUI(mCaptureTimeLapse); - mActivity.runOnUiThread(new Runnable() { - public void run() { - Size size = mParameters.getPreviewSize(); - SurfaceHolder sh = mUI.getSurfaceHolder(); - if ( sh != null ){ - sh.setFixedSize(size.width-2, size.height-2); - } - } - }); } // Preview texture has been copied. Now camera can be released and the |